
Paolo Bea, Umbria Rosso San Valentino, 2008
Uncompromising, hand-made Umbrian red from one of the godfathers of Italian natural wine. Giampiero Bea, co-founder of Vini Veri, makes Montefalco wines the old way: native yeasts, long slow fermentations, years in big neutral casks, and bottling without fining or filtration. San Valentino blends Sangiovese with the region's brooding Sagrantino and some Montepulciano, off clay soils at around 1,300 feet. The 2008 is a mature bottle from a private collection, drinking in its complex tertiary phase. Give it a long decant; Bea's wines reward patience and air.
